[12] Hac ratione saepe rimae callo quodam inplentur estque ea ossis uelut cicatrix; et latius fracta ossa, si qua inter se non cohaerebant, eodem callo glutinantur estque id aliquanto melius uelamentum cerebro quam caro, quae exciso osse increscit. Si uero sub prima curatione febris intenditur breuesque somni et idem per somnia tumultuosi sunt, ulcus madet neque alitur, et in ceruicibus glandulae oriuntur, magni dolores sunt, cibique super haec fastidium increscit, tum demum ad manum scalprumque ueniendum est.
